Meeting of local residents speaks against HPP construction in Pankisi

At a meeting convoked in the village of Djokolo, residents of the Pankisi Gorge spoke against the construction of a chain of hydropower plants (HPPs) in the gorge, as well as against the detention of their fellow villagers, who had taken part in clashes with the police.

The "Caucasian Knot" has reported that on April 21, in Georgia, several hundreds of residents of the Pankisi Gorge gathered for a spontaneous rally in the village of Birkiani in the Akhmeta District to prevent the planned construction of the small "Khadori-3" HPP. During the protest action, clashes occurred between protesters and law enforcers.

The above meeting was held on April 24. The participants discussed an action plan aimed to suspend the construction and the events of April 21. The meeting spoke against the construction and supported their fellow villagers who took part in clashes with law enforcers, the "Georgia Online" reports.

The meeting lasted for about three hours; the villagers have rejected any possibility of a dialogue with the authorities on the construction of a new HPP on the Alazani River, the "Echo of the Caucasus" reports.

"Minister Gakhariya has promised us that HPPs will be built only if 90 percent of the respective population give their consent. We hereby declare that we are against the construction; and there will be no negotiations on this issue," the Georgian Channel One quotes Zaur Bagakashvili, a local resident, on its website.

  • Court values prisoner’s torture in Rostov prison hospital at 100,000 roubles

    A court in Rostov-on-Don has valued the moral suffering of a prisoner who spent 71 days roped to a bed at the FSIN (Russian Federal Penitentiary Service) tuberculosis hospital at 100,000 roubles. Other prisoners who were tortured there are also seeking compensations, but the court ordered the FSIN to pay them 50,000 roubles each.

  • Kadyrov boasts about mentioning "Akhmat" in Kremlin

    The head of Chechnya has reacted to Putin's mentioning of two "Akhmat" units in the list of the units that took part in battles in the Kursk Region, dedicating a separate post to this in his Telegram channel. Apti Alaudinov, the commander of the "Akhmat" special-purpose troops, reported that the unit has not yet changed its location.

  • Detention of Yakhya Magomedov outrages social media users

    Social media users have expressed their outrage over the detention of Yakhya Magomedov, the Imam of the Khasavyurt Central Mosque. They recalled his confrontation with the Muftiate and drew parallels with the criminal prosecution of Imams in Ingushetia.
